Robocopy - /MIR: behouden nieuwste file

Pagina: 1
Acties:

Vraag


Acties:
  • 0 Henk 'm!

  • Pharos1985
  • Registratie: November 2014
  • Laatst online: 16:29
Beste,

Ik heb 2 folders: laat het ons voor de makkelijkheid folder A & folder B noemen. Beide folders bevatten 100.000files en wel 1000 submappen (soms genest).
Ze zijn al eens gekopieerd in het verleden (vandaar hebben we nu deze problemen 8)7

Ik zou een methode moeten vinden om folder A naar folder B te kopieren of te mirroren én indien er al files bestaan in folder B moet:
- De nieuwste file behouden blijven.
- Dit kan zowel een file zijn die zich dus al in Folder B bevindt (dan moet er dus niets gebeuren), maar indien de file op folderA nieuwer is, moet deze file in FolderB overschreven worden met het nieuwere bestand.

Ik heb /XO & /XN al zitten bekijken maar kom er niet echt aan uit.
FolderA gaat na de copy verwijderd worden maar zou toch liefst intact blijven voor mocht er überhaupt iets foutlopen.

Iemand hier ervaring mee?

Bedankt!

Beste antwoord (via Pharos1985 op 16-11-2022 23:09)


  • Orinoko
  • Registratie: Februari 2022
  • Laatst online: 12-08 19:33
Waarom zou het volgende niet werken. Dat is toch wat je wilt of lees ik het verkeerd?
code:
1
ROBOCOPY "FolderA" "FolderB" /S /XO

[ Voor 8% gewijzigd door Orinoko op 16-11-2022 09:05 ]

Alle reacties


Acties:
  • 0 Henk 'm!

  • MAX3400
  • Registratie: Mei 2003
  • Laatst online: 13:08

MAX3400

XBL: OctagonQontrol

Ander pakket of technologie gebruiken.

Alternatief is een eigen scriptje maken/schrijven; van beide lokaties een "tree" maken met de modified attributes. Dan de 2 outputs gebruiken als input voor een "definitieve" kopie van A en B naar C.

En volgens mij kan dit dus (ook) als je eerst alles van A naar C kopieert (via Explorer) en daarna B ook naar C kopieert. Dan krijg je per file de vraag wat je ermee wil doen.

Of via FileZilla? Die heeft ook een "overwrite newer" optie, dacht ik?

Overigens; ik gok Windows waar je mee werkt? Of wat had je zelf al gevonden / geprobeerd?

Mijn advertenties!!! | Mijn antwoorden zijn vaak niet snowflake-proof


Acties:
  • 0 Henk 'm!

  • Pharos1985
  • Registratie: November 2014
  • Laatst online: 16:29
Beste,

Bedankt alvast voor je berichtje. Ik gebruik inderdaad Windows als OS, het gaat enkel over copy tussen 2 Windows mappen op NTFS volume.
Ik heb al volgende geprobeerd:
- Gewerkt met Vice Versa Pro (een fully functional trial van 30 dagen).
- Robocopy: zowel met /XN als /XO geprobeerd, maar het lijkt me niet te lukken zoals ik het wil.

Ik wil FileZilla wel proberen, ik weet niet of het een hoge leercurve heeft.
Wel zou ik zeker support nodig hebben voor meer dan 256 karakters.

Ik gebruik liever native dingen zoals Robocopy, maar indien het natuurlijk daarmee gewoon niet mogelijk is, zal ik wel moeten uitwijken naar alternatieven.

Nog iemand tips?

Bedankt!

Acties:
  • 0 Henk 'm!

  • Pharos1985
  • Registratie: November 2014
  • Laatst online: 16:29
By the way: is FileZilla niet gewoon een FTPclient/server???

Acties:
  • 0 Henk 'm!

  • PD2JK
  • Registratie: Augustus 2001
  • Laatst online: 20:34

PD2JK

ouwe meuk is leuk

FreeFileSync dan? Veel opties, gebruik het voor mijn backups.

Heeft van alles wat: 8088 - 286 - 386 - 486 - 5x86C - P54CS - P55C - P6:Pro/II/III/Xeon - K7 - NetBurst :') - Core 2 - K8 - Core i$ - Zen$


Acties:
  • 0 Henk 'm!

  • The_Doman
  • Registratie: Augustus 2005
  • Laatst online: 20:50
Total Commander dan?
Deze heeft diverse copy/filesync opties.

Afbeeldingslocatie: https://tweakers.net/i/xHS1ltnt0bEdc0vgSL_y-9iim14=/800x/filters:strip_exif()/f/image/n5MyaEzN2VmNRemNH1BvfnVa.png?f=fotoalbum_large

Acties:
  • Beste antwoord
  • 0 Henk 'm!

  • Orinoko
  • Registratie: Februari 2022
  • Laatst online: 12-08 19:33
Waarom zou het volgende niet werken. Dat is toch wat je wilt of lees ik het verkeerd?
code:
1
ROBOCOPY "FolderA" "FolderB" /S /XO

[ Voor 8% gewijzigd door Orinoko op 16-11-2022 09:05 ]


Acties:
  • 0 Henk 'm!

  • Pharos1985
  • Registratie: November 2014
  • Laatst online: 16:29
Orinoko schreef op woensdag 16 november 2022 @ 09:03:
Waarom zou het volgende niet werken. Dat is toch wat je wilt of lees ik het verkeerd?
code:
1
ROBOCOPY "FolderA" "FolderB" /S /XO
Bedankt, is exact wat ik zoek maar ik had dat verkeerd geïntepreteerd.
Zou jij dat dan copyen zonder /MIR te gebruiken?

Acties:
  • +1 Henk 'm!

  • Orinoko
  • Registratie: Februari 2022
  • Laatst online: 12-08 19:33
Met de optie /MIR worden mappen verwijderd die alleen in FolderB bestaan. Je spiegelt letterlijk de mappenstructuur van FolderA naar FolderB. Volgens mij wil je dat juist niet.
Pagina: 1